The Real estate listing agreement cancellation form for texas in Cook is a formal document that stipulates the mutual termination of a listing agreement between a real estate broker and a seller. This form requires both parties to acknowledge the original listing agreement’s date and specify the termination date. Key features include a waiver by the broker of any claims against the seller due to the termination, although they may seek reimbursement for any incurred advertising and marketing expenses. The seller releases the broker from any further obligations under the agreement, while ensuring that any commissions earned prior to termination are preserved. The Termination Process Study Your Contract: Look for any specific instructions about how to end the agreement. Understand Acceptable Reasons: Your contract might list specific reasons that allow you to terminate. Talk to Your Agent: Before you do anything official, try talking to your agent.

Why can you terminate a listing agreement? Poor communication: You may cancel a listing agreement due to an agent's poor performance. Bad marketing: Real estate is competitive, even in a seller's market. Unethical behavior: Agents have a fiduciary duty to serve a home seller honestly and ethically.

If I was wanting to cancel, the first thing I would do is contact the listing agent and explain why you want to cancel. Most of the time the listing agent will release you from the agreement. If they are resistant to releasing you from the agreement contact their Broker/manager and explain.
